Orange Beach has long been known as the Red Snapper Capital of the World. With thousands of artificial reefs nearshore providing some of the best bottom fishing in the world, and excellent inshore and offshore fishing, Orange Beach, Alabama is one of the top fishing destinations worldwide.
With one of the largest artificial reef systems in the world, Orange Beach provides legendary nearshore fishing action. Bottom fishing and trolling around these reefs will produce good catches of a variety of reef fish, including Red Snapper, Mangrove Snapper (Black Snapper), Lane Snapper, Vermillion Snapper, Gag Grouper, Red Grouper, King Mackerel, Amberjacks, Barracuda, and Sharks.
Inshore fishing around Orange Beach provides excellent Redfish fishing nearly year round. The Speckled Trout fishing is also great a good portion of the year, with the highlight being in the fall. Black Drum, Bluefish, Flounder, Sheepshead, and Tripletail are also some of the most targeted species of fish in the bay and close to shore.
Offshore fishing Orange Beach can produce Blackfin, Bonito, and Yellowfin Tuna, Wahoo, and Dolphin (Mahi-mahi). For longer trips, there are also Blue Marlin in the Spring and Summer. There is also good White Marlin fishing between August and October.
